In this blog, I&#8217;ll delve into the factors that determine the difficulty of removing a support bracket and offer some insights based on my years of experience in the industry.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.foncher.com\/support-bracket\/\">Support Bracket<\/a><\/p>\n<p><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.foncher.com\/uploads\/47149\/small\/embedded-door-handleb04da.jpg\"><\/p>\n<h4>Factors Affecting the Difficulty of Removal<\/h4>\n<h5>Installation Method<\/h5>\n<p>The way a support bracket is installed plays a crucial role in how difficult it will be to remove. For instance, if a bracket is installed using simple bolt &#8211; on methods, it&#8217;s generally easier to remove. Bolts can be loosened with the appropriate wrenches. However, the size and type of bolts matter. Hex bolts are common and can usually be unfastened with a standard hex wrench or socket set. If the bolts are very large or have a special head design, like Torx or Allen heads, you&#8217;ll need the corresponding tools.<\/p>\n<p>On the other hand, brackets that are welded in place pose a greater challenge. Welding creates a strong, permanent bond between the bracket and the surface it&#8217;s attached to. To remove a welded support bracket, you&#8217;ll typically need to use a cutting tool, such as a grinder or a plasma cutter. These tools require skill and safety precautions, as they can generate a lot of heat and sparks.<\/p>\n<h5>Corrosion and Rust<\/h5>\n<p>Over time, support brackets are exposed to various environmental conditions. Corrosion and rust can significantly increase the difficulty of removal. When metal corrodes, it can cause the bolts to seize up or become fused to the bracket and the mounting surface. In such cases, simply trying to turn the bolt can lead to the bolt head stripping, making the removal process even more complicated.<\/p>\n<p>To deal with corrosion, you may need to use penetrating oils. These oils are designed to seep into the threads of the bolts and break down the rust. However, if the corrosion is severe, more drastic measures might be required, such as drilling out the seized bolts.<\/p>\n<h5>Location and Accessibility<\/h5>\n<p>The location of the support bracket also affects the ease of removal. If the bracket is in an easily accessible area, it&#8217;s much simpler to work on. You can easily reach the bolts or cutting tools and have enough space to move them around.<\/p>\n<p>However, if the bracket is located in a tight or hard &#8211; to &#8211; reach space, like inside a machinery enclosure or behind other components, it becomes a more difficult task. You may need to disassemble other parts to gain access to the bracket, which adds time and complexity to the removal process.<\/p>\n<h5>Material of the Bracket and the Mounting Surface<\/h5>\n<p>The materials of both the support bracket and the surface it&#8217;s attached to can influence removal difficulty. For example, if the bracket is made of a soft metal like aluminum and is attached to a hard steel surface, there&#8217;s a risk of the bracket deforming during removal.<\/p>\n<p>In addition, if the bracket and the mounting surface are made of the same material and have been in contact for a long time, there could be a phenomenon called galling. Galling occurs when the surfaces rub against each other and transfer metal particles, causing them to stick together. This makes it challenging to separate the bracket from the surface.<\/p>\n<h4>Strategies for Easier Removal<\/h4>\n<h5>Preparation<\/h5>\n<p>Proper preparation is key to a successful bracket removal. First, gather all the necessary tools. This includes wrenches, screwdrivers, cutting tools, and any other specialized equipment depending on the installation method. It&#8217;s also a good idea to have safety gear, such as gloves, goggles, and a face shield.<\/p>\n<p>Before starting the removal process, take some time to examine the bracket and its installation. Look for any signs of corrosion or damage, and plan your approach accordingly. If you suspect there might be seized bolts, apply a penetrating oil a few hours or even a day before you plan to remove them.<\/p>\n<h5>Step &#8211; by &#8211; Step Approach<\/h5>\n<p>When removing a bolt &#8211; on bracket, start by loosening all the bolts slightly before completely removing them. This helps to ensure that the bracket is evenly released and reduces the risk of it getting stuck or causing damage to the surrounding area.<\/p>\n<p>For welded brackets, make sure to mark the area where you&#8217;ll be making the cuts. Use a straight edge or a template to ensure clean and accurate cuts. When using a cutting tool, follow the manufacturer&#8217;s instructions carefully and take breaks to avoid overheating the tool.<\/p>\n<h5>Professional Help<\/h5>\n<p>If you&#8217;re unsure about the removal process or if the bracket is in a particularly difficult location, it might be a good idea to seek professional help.
